Skip to main content

Table 6 Example ROI tracking data that can be seen in the database table. Column 1 - 3 are labels added using JavaScript, column 4 is the duration calculated from the difference between dates, column 5 is the area manually labelled by the administrator and the rest of the columns are total value of data retrieved from the DOM API

From: Using real-time online preprocessed mouse tracking for lower storage and transmission costs

ID

Name

Date 2019/3/01

Duration (second)

Area (x1,x2,y1,y2)

Left clicks

Right clicks

Middle clicks

Mouse moves

Scrolls

1

Student 1

11:06:39

14.148

{“header”:[0,1920,0,64]}

0

0

0

1

1

2

Student 1

11:06:40

1.179

{“quiz1”:[529,1900,291,570]}

0

0

0

86

0

...

...

...

...

...

...

...

...

...

...

19062

Student 23

14:44:09

0.002

{“title”:[16,1904,150,270]}

0

0

0

1

0